Animal Discoveries 2011 – A Summary<br />

The <strong>Zoological</strong> <strong>Survey</strong> <strong>of</strong> <strong>India</strong> (ZSI) was established in 1916 as a national centre<br />

for zoology - an institute to survey and explore the faunal resources <strong>of</strong> the country<br />

and its documentation, taxonomic research and creating environmental awareness.<br />

The scientists and naturalists <strong>of</strong> the country have watched with admiration the<br />

development <strong>of</strong> the <strong>Zoological</strong> <strong>Survey</strong>, and the gravitation to it <strong>of</strong> many <strong>of</strong> their<br />

specimens and several <strong>of</strong> their finest collections.<br />

During 2011, 193 new species and 66 new records <strong>of</strong> <strong>animal</strong>s discovered, described<br />

and reported from <strong>India</strong>.<br />

ESTIMATED FAUNAL DIVERSITY IN INDIA<br />

In the light <strong>of</strong> Biodiversity Convention, <strong>India</strong> holds a unique position with the priority<br />

<strong>of</strong> conservation <strong>of</strong> natural resources and sustainable development. <strong>India</strong> is very rich in<br />

terms <strong>of</strong> biological diversity due to its unique biogeographical location, diversified climatic<br />

conditions and enormous ecodiversity and geodiversity. Infact, within only about 2% <strong>of</strong><br />

world’s total land surface, <strong>India</strong> is known to have over 7.50% <strong>of</strong> the species <strong>of</strong> <strong>animal</strong>s that<br />

the world holds and this percentage accounts nearly for 92,034 species so far known, <strong>of</strong><br />

which insects alone include 61,375 species. It is estimated that about two times that number<br />

<strong>of</strong> species still remains to be discovered in <strong>India</strong> alone.<br />

Remarks : Monopterus ichthyophoides is described from specimens collected from the Sawleng<br />

River and a public well at Luangmual, both in the Barak River drainage in Mizoram, <strong>India</strong>.<br />

The new species differs from all other synbranchids in having only two, instead <strong>of</strong> five<br />

or six branchiostegal rays. It belongs to the Amphipnous species group characterized by<br />

possession <strong>of</strong> scales on the body and can be readily distinguished from all other species<br />

<strong>of</strong> this group by the lower number <strong>of</strong> vertebrae (114–117 vs 126–188).<br />

Remarks : Glyptothorax dikrongensis can be differentiated from all congeners, except G.<br />

indicus, G. rugimentum and G. obliquimaculatus, by the presence <strong>of</strong> an unculiferous patch<br />

on the posterior region <strong>of</strong> the lower lip, in between the inner mandibular-barbel bases,<br />

and unculiferous striae <strong>of</strong> the thoracic adhesive apparatus extending anteriorly onto the<br />

gular region. Glyptothorax dikrongensisis distinguished from G. indicus by the following<br />

combination <strong>of</strong> characters : equal distance between the posterior end <strong>of</strong> the pectoral-fin<br />

base and the pelvic-fin origin and between the pelvic-fin and the anal-fin origin (vs.<br />

distance between posterior end <strong>of</strong> pectoral-fin base and pelvic-fin origin greater than<br />

between pelvic-fin origin and anal-fin origin), and the pelvic-fin origin anterior to or almost<br />

at a vertical through the posterior end <strong>of</strong> the dorsal-fin base (vs. posterior to the dorsalfin<br />

base). Glyptothorax dikrongensis is distinguished from G. rugimentum in lacking vertical<br />

bars on the body and caudal peduncle, and having a deeper caudal peduncle (8.4-9.2 vs.<br />

6.1-7.6% SL) and a shorter dorsal-fin spine (10.1-11.1 vs. 15.2-18.6% SL). It is distinguished<br />

from G. obliquimaculatus in lacking dark, oblique blotches on the body, and in having a<br />

shorter dorsal-fin spine (10.1-11.1 vs. 13.4-16.4% SL).<br />

Remarks : This large sized (SVL to at least 110.6 mm), rupicolous gecko differs from<br />

congeners in having 16–18 longitudinal rows <strong>of</strong> fairly regularly arranged, subtrihedral,<br />

weakly keeled, striated tubercles at midbody; 9–11 and 12–13 subdigital lamellae on the<br />

first and fourth digits, respectively, <strong>of</strong> both manus and pes; tail with transverse series <strong>of</strong><br />

four enlarged tubercles on each tail segment; 23–28 femoral pores on each side separated<br />

by 1–3 poreless scales; 12–14 supralabials and 9–11 infralabials. Molecular data support<br />

the distinctiveness <strong>of</strong> the new species and its affinities with large-bodied,<br />

tuberculate Hemidactylus spp. from <strong>India</strong> and Sri Lanka.
